Bahrain F1 Test: Norris Fastest, Williams Leads Laps

McLaren's Lando Norris set the pace on day one of Formula 1's Bahrain pre-season test, posting a best lap of 1:34.669 to top the timesheets. The 2026 season opener preparations continued with teams evaluating new regulations including increased electric power and recharge modes. Max Verstappen (+0.129s) and Charles Leclerc (+0.521s) completed the top three.

Williams dominated the mileage charts, completing 145 laps - more than any other team. Red Bull (136 laps) and Ferrari (132 laps) followed in the distance rankings. The test features 18 drivers across Thursday's sessions, with teams rotating their line-ups throughout the four sessions. Notable participants include rookie Kimi Antonelli for Mercedes and established stars like Lewis Hamilton and Sergio Perez.

The Bahrain test marks the first of three pre-season sessions before the Australian Grand Prix on March 6-8. Teams have two weeks between tests to analyze data before the second Bahrain test from February 18-20. With new technical regulations introducing more electric power and different engine suppliers, this week's running provides crucial early indicators of competitive balance ahead of the season opener.
